Possibly the most attractive aspect of a UPVC French door is the security that they offer for your home. These days this is one of the most important factors you have when selecting a door.

We all want our homes to be secure and more importantly we want our families to feel safe. The latest technology is used in creating doors these days so there is no need to worry. Obviously you can't guarantee the worst from happening but we can do our best to help prevent it.

This brings me onto the final advantage of a UPVC French door... it will last for years with very little care. You won't have to treat them like you do with other doors. All you need to do is wash them occasionally.
